83.16 percent of the population in 16248 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 57.81 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 14.41 percent of the residents in 16248 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.29 members with about 2.29 cars available per household.
An estimate of 93.83 percent of the residents in 16248 has some form of health insurance. 54.59 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 60.70 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 16248 would have to travel an average of 12.33 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Clarion Psychiatric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 16248, Rimersburg, Pennsylvania.

As of , an estimate of 3,127 residents live in 16248 with a median age of 49.5 years. 18.16 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 24.62 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 34.36 percent of the residents in 16248 is currently married, and 19.71 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 16248 is $5,284.75.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 16248 is approximately $556. The median household spends about 10.52 percent of their income on housing.
